We're not from New Zealand — do we need a license to operate a boat here?

Owning a boat in New Zealand is very easy. Owners and operators of private boats are not required to hold any license, or have the boat registered. However, we recommend that our owners check with their insurance companies to make sure they are meeting the requirements for their cover.

What does monthly boat maintenance include?

Our standard monthly maintenance covers a full washdown and detail, engine and bilge checks, battery and electrical checks, and a general inspection of mooring lines and fenders. Anything beyond this — such as servicing, antifouling, or repairs — is quoted separately and always agreed with you first.

How long can we stay in New Zealand at one time?

For most nationalities, including the US, UK and Europe, visitors can stay in New Zealand under a tourist visa for up to 90 days.
